Understanding FIFO Mining Operations

Decoding the FIFO System

FIFO mining involves a unique work arrangement where employees commute to the mining site for a set period before returning home. This system is designed to optimize workforce management, but its success is intricately tied to how well various elements, including shift lengths, are structured.

The Influence of Shift Length on Individual Performance

Short vs. Long Shifts: Striking the Balance

In the realm of FIFO mining, the duration of work shifts directly affects individual performance. Short shifts may reduce fatigue but can lead to frequent turnovers, impacting overall efficiency. On the other hand, long shifts may increase fatigue, potentially diminishing productivity. Striking the right balance is imperative for sustained high performance.

The Role of Rest Periods

Balancing the length of shifts is not only about the hours spent working but also the quality of rest periods. Adequate rest is crucial to combatting fatigue, and careful consideration of break times can contribute significantly to maintaining a productive workforce.

The Domino Effect on Overall Productivity

Ripple Effects on Team Dynamics

Shift lengths have a domino effect on team dynamics. Coordinating the activities of a diverse group of individuals requires a thoughtful approach to shift planning. The right balance ensures seamless transitions, minimizing disruptions and optimizing overall productivity.

Impact on Equipment Utilization

Efficient mining operations hinge not only on human factors but also on the utilization of heavy machinery. Shift lengths influence equipment usage patterns, with longer shifts allowing for continuous operation but raising concerns about machinery fatigue.

Addressing Challenges and Optimizing Productivity

Strategies for Enhancing Productivity

To navigate the challenges posed by varying shift lengths, mining operations can implement strategies such as personalized schedules, advanced fatigue monitoring systems, and employee wellness programs. These measures contribute to a more productive and resilient workforce.

Technological Solutions in Workforce Management

Embracing technological advancements in workforce management can streamline shift planning, ensuring optimal productivity. From AI-driven scheduling to real-time fatigue monitoring, technology offers solutions to enhance overall efficiency in FIFO mining operations.
